Scholarships for international undergraduate business students in the USA?

I'm planning to pursue a business degree in the USA and wondering what scholarship opportunities are available for international students. Any info on which universities offer the best scholarships or where to find them would be super helpful!

a year ago

Sure! Many U.S. institutions offer scholarships, both merit-based and need-based, for international students aiming to pursue a business degree. Let me provide some examples:

1. New York University (NYU): NYU's Stern School of Business has a limited number of scholarships available for international students. They are most typically merit-based based on students' academic and extracurricular records.

2. Harvard University: Although Harvard Business School mostly caters to graduate students, Harvard College—where undergraduates study—does offer need-based financial aid to international students, just like domestic ones. Harvard has strong programs in econ, which a large number of students use as a foundation for a career in business.

3. University of Pennsylvania (UPenn): The Wharton School at UPenn, one of the top undergraduate business schools, offers financial aid packages to a limited number of international students each year.

4. Yale University: Yale also follows a need-based financial aid model and funds are available for international students. Based on their family income, they may qualify for scholarships that cover a substantial percentage of tuition, room, and board costs.

5. Dartmouth College: Dartmouth offers need-based scholarships to international students. Dartmouth's approach to liberal arts education provides a strong foundation for students interested in business.

As for where to search for scholarships, one effective way is to check out the financial aid pages of the universities you're interested in. It's important to do your research and reach out directly to the universities for the most precise and up-to-date information as offerings may change from year to year.

Remember, scholarships often have deadlines that can be a year ahead of when you plan to start studying, so start searching early and stay organized to get your applications in on time.
